The Civil Society Index was implemented in Pakistan in 2001 by the Aga Khan Foundation, with the international coordination of CIVICUS. This implementation led to a report presenting the results of the CSI initiative in the country.

CSI Country Report in Pakistan 2001

Pakistan’s civil society organisations are still struggling with a number of factors relating to their practices and values, adapting to new modes of social life between authoritarian legacies and democratic aspirations, exhibition of conflicting worldviews with opposing interests, which altogether, hampers their success.

The study recommends stronger partnerships with other developmental stakeholders in other to build on their priorities and to discover areas of greater partnerships.
